Strengthening Democracy

Advocacy and policy efforts play a significant role in our democracy. Grassroots organizing, litigation, and public education are some of the ways advocacy work can effect policy change, and it’s crucial that communities of color are not just at decision-making tables, but setting priorities and leading change efforts. Racial Justice

Racial inequity intersects nearly every issue in society -- from access to education to the environment to the quality of healthcare. And for centuries, communities of color have been denied wealth-building opportunities. Browse nonprofits focused on centering BIPOC-led solutions.

Climate Justice

While we’re all facing the negative consequences of a warming earth, the impacts of climate change are disproportionately felt by some communities -- those that already face the most disadvantages. Browse nonprofits focused on community-led solutions, powerbuilding, and policy change.

Immigrants and Refugees

Millions of immigrants and refugees call the U.S. home, but racism, abuse, policies and other barriers prevent many people from thriving. In addition, there is a dearth of philanthropic funding to immigrant and refugee populations. Browse nonprofits focused on movement building and other systems change efforts.
